Experimental Analysis of Coherent Neutron Flux Fluctuations Observed in a Pressurized Water Reactor
1998
Plant signals from the Borssele nuclear power plant in the Netherlands were analyzed to investigate the characteristics of neutron flux fluctuation in the low-frequency range 0 to 0.5 Hz, focusing on its spatially coherent motion. The second azimuthal oscillation mode was observed at the frequency of ∼0.03 Hz while the corewide oscillation mode was at ∼0.1 Hz, and the fluctuation at the corewide mode was much stronger.
